There’s more to EV charging than most people think.
Most electricians can mount a charger on a wall. Not all of them will tell you when your DB board isn’t ready for one — or when that portable unit from the dealership is quietly overloading your kitchen circuit at 16 amps, every single night.
I will. Because this is the only work I do.
Before I touch a single cable, I assess your electrical capacity, the position of your DB board, and how your charger needs to be configured. You get a written proposal with honest recommendations — including if I think you don’t need me.

Overnight charging
Full battery by morning
A proper Level 2 install charges your EV in 6–8 hours — up to 8x faster than a standard outlet. Plug in at night, leave full.
Cost savings
Up to R1,000/m saved
Home charging on off-peak rates is a fraction of public charging. I can configure your charger to do this automatically.
Solar homes
Works with your inverter
I configure chargers to integrate with existing solar systems — drawing clean, cheap energy when it’s most available.
Full compliance
CoC on every install
Every job includes a Certificate of Compliance. Your insurer requires it. It’s included as standard — not an add-on.

Transparent pricing
What does an installation cost?
Most EV and PHEV purchases include a complimentary portable charger. But getting it properly installed — safely, legally, and efficiently — is a separate step. Here’s what to expect:
| Home installation Dedicated circuit, isolator, separate earth leakage, cabling & CoC |
~R4,000 |
| Charger hardware Depending on smart features & load management capability |
R10k – R20k |
| Site assessment & written proposal | FREE |
